Board Of Directors
A group of individuals elected by shareholders to oversee the management and make key decisions for a corporation.
Derivative-Action Provision
A component in corporate governance that allows a shareholder to sue or take legal action on behalf of the corporation, often against directors or management for misconduct.
Corporate Opportunity
A business opportunity or prospect that a corporation's directors, officers, or employees might have a duty to offer to the corporation before pursuing independently.
